By joining our family-owned business now, you can achieve more from your career by proudly building Britains future heritage with us.The Sustainability Manager roleTo manage the delivery of the Sir Robert McAlpine sustainability strategy and client requirements on projects within the London Region.To deliver the requirements of the role the successful candidate will work closely with the Regional Sustainability Manager and construction project teams. The successful candidate should have experience in construction environmental management and deliveringprojects which are aligned to our sustainability strategys four category areas, namely Carbon, Resource Efficiency, Ethical Procurement and Social ValueResponsibilities

  • Managing delivery of the company & client sustainability requirements from preconstruction to practical completion
  • Ensuring our EMS is implemented on projects from tender stage with support from the Regional Sustainability Manager
  • Technically review, advising and managing delivery of improve sustainability performance and environmental assessments (e.g., BREEAM, WELL, HQM, LEED)
  • Ensuring that procurement documentation reflects the project sustainability requirements
  • Ensuring that projects and supply chain comply with the requirements of legislation through regular site surveillances and audits
  • Managing projects to reduce carbon emissions & waste and ensuring that goods and services are ethically procured.
  • Ensuring each project understands their Clients sustainability requirements (including delivery of environmental assessments e.g., BREEAM, Section 106 agreements etc.)
  • Liaising with external stakeholders
  • Reporting project performance against Build Sure and client requirements in line with the company reporting requirements
  • Reviewing project performance, identifying, and addressing areas of improvement
  • Communicating our strategy aims and achievements coherently, getting buy in from wider staff base
  • Identifying and communicating best practice across the business unit
  • Delivery of training on environmental management and sustainability for the project staff and supply chain
Essential Skills and Qualifications
  • Minimum 2 years experience in a construction environmental / sustainability role
  • Qualifications / strong knowledge of environmental assessment methods (BREEAM, LEED, HQM etc).
